38' Belgium's Goal!
Romelu Lukaku scored after the Belgians won several rebounds in the box, the ball reached the Inter striker and after turning to face the goal he scored with his right foot.

History between Belgium and Croatia
These two teams have met seven times: four in World Cup qualifiers, one in friendlies and two in Euro qualifiers. The numbers favor the Croatians, who have won three of these duels, while the Belgians have won two, the same number of draws they have signed.

Stadium
The game will be played at the King Baudouin Stadium, located in the Heysel district of Brussels, Belgium.
